Decoding Immunotherapy: Empowering the Body to Fight Back
To understand why alternative breast cancer treatments in Mexico are so effective, one must grasp the fundamental science of immunotherapy. The human immune system is incredibly proficient at identifying and destroying abnormal cells on a daily basis. However, breast cancer cells are notoriously deceptive. They undergo genetic mutations that allow them to "hide" from immune surveillance, often by expressing specific proteins (like PD-L1) that essentially turn off the body's T-cells, signaling them to stand down.

Advanced Protocols: Dendritic Cell Vaccines
Among the most promising and sought-after therapies available in Tijuana's medical hubs is the Dendritic Cell Vaccine. Dendritic cells are specialized immune cells that act as the intelligence-gatherers of the immune system. They patrol the body, capture foreign antigens, and present them to T-cells, essentially handing the T-cells a "wanted poster" of the enemy they need to hunt down and destroy.
The Custom Vaccine Culturing Process
The creation of a dendritic cell vaccine is a highly personalized medical process. First, blood is drawn from the breast cancer patient. In a specialized laboratory, the patient's monocytes (a type of white blood cell) are isolated and cultured with specific cytokines to mature into potent dendritic cells. These newly formed cells are then exposed directly to the patient's specific tumor antigens or synthetic markers associated with their breast cancer subtype.

Natural Killer (NK) Cell Therapy: The Frontline Defenders
Alongside dendritic vaccines, Natural Killer (NK) Cell Therapy is a cornerstone of integrative cancer therapies in Mexico. While T-cells require a specific antigen presentation to attack, NK cells are part of the innate immune system. They do not need prior exposure or a "wanted poster" to identify malignant cells. They are biologically programmed to detect cellular abnormalities, such as the down-regulation of major histocompatibility complex (MHC) class I molecules, which is a common trait of invasive breast cancer cells.

Inducing Apoptosis in Malignant Tissue
Upon re-entering the bloodstream, this massive army of NK cells immediately goes to work. When an NK cell binds to a breast cancer cell, it releases cytotoxic granules containing perforin and granzymes. Perforin punches microscopic holes in the tumor cell's membrane, allowing granzymes to enter and trigger apoptosis—programmed cell death.
